Шлюхи без блекджека, блекджек без шлюх. Войти !bnw Сегодня Клубы
Привет, TbI — HRWKA! 1239.2 пользователей не могут ошибаться!
?6940
прекрасное6442
говно5903
говнорашка5512
хуита4706
anime3064
linux2649
music2632
bnw2597
рашка2565
log2352
ололо2151
pic1815
дунч1808
сталирасты1491
украина1439
быдло1436
bnw_ppl1409
дыбр1238
гімно1158

git push на github.com перестал работать. Connection timeout. Пришлось использовать костыли ввиде ssh.github.com:443. Походу теле2 тестирует новый dpi :-/
#STLSIJ (1) / @bga_ / 172 дня назад
dev
> Непопулярное мнение: JavaScript единственный язык, который сделал правильные числа. 64 бита, которые одновременно и целое до 53-х бит, и с плавающей точкой если больше. Ну просто подумайте: в какой жизненной ситуации вам нужны целые больше 53-х бит? Это 9*10^15, девять ебучих квадриллионов, девять тыщ триллионов то есть. Чтобы представлять что? Вокруг нас просто нет предметов в таком количестве (кроме размера node_modules). Девять тыщ терабайт, если в байтах. То есть 53 бита достаточно каждому. Даже в указателях только 48 используется (хаха, а вы что, думали 64? Щас). Ну а иметь один числовой тип вместо двух как будто тоже гениально? Все в выигрыше, никто не пострадал. Почему же тогда подход JS не нравится «настоящим программистам»? Да потому что все остальные наловчились в 64 бита рассовывать разное, нужно им это или не нужно. То есть по сути единственная причина, почему это неудобно, это другие языки, которые пришли раньше и у которых конвенция другая. Они может все 64 бита и не используют, но _потенциально_ могут, и в итоге приходится под них подстраиваться. А нужно наоборот, чтобы все подстраивались под JavaScript (который на самом деле IEEE 754 double-precision float, если вам так больше нравится). Но как же битовые операции, скажете вы? Как мне всякие там сдвиги считать? Ну чувак, битовые операции на числах это страшный хак, раз уж мы о типах заговорили. Они должны на байтах делаться, а не на числах. А всякие int64/uint64 это от лукавого. Должен быть только number64.
#1088F6 (2) / @bga_ / 262 дня назад
> Мне не надо ничего дописывать, мне надо чтобы когда я переношу функцию из файла «a» в файл «b», во всем местах программы где эта функция используется, «from a import function» изменилось на «from b import function». Я же вроде не многого прошу? Про подобные элементарные вещи в 2024м году стыдно говорить вообще, но почему-то хваленый имакс этого не умеет. > > Я не пишу на питоне, поэтому не скажу. В C/C++ проектах eglot автоматически #include’ы дописывает. > Вот так и рождается миф о могучем GNU Emacs. Сколько есть роликов на ютубе рекламирующих силу и мощь имакса, это всегда какой-то флуд про орг-мод (да нахер он мне не нужон ваш орг-мод), какие-то рассказы про «перешёл на имакс и не жалею», какие-то хелло-ворды в качестве примера, а когда дело доходит до конкретики - ну… я сам этим не пользуюсь, ну… попробуй другой плагин, ну… это юникс-вей ты просто не понимаешь. Да не хочу я понимать, я хочу чтобы программа работала из коробки и помогала мне автоматизировать рутину. Я не хочу ковыряться в лиспе, не хочу знать что там под капотом есть какой-то eglot, я не хочу компилировать Emacs из исходников, чтобы активировать поддержку treesitter, я знать не хочу что такое treesitter, это не нужно мне чтобы писать программы в рамках моих компетенций. И более всего я не хочу ничем из всего этого набора веселых равлечений для кружка «собери себе ИДЕ из говна и палок» заниматься потому, что даже после всех ковыряний, настроек и допилок оно не работает, как надо. Ты удаляешь файл в одном плагине, но он продолжает отображаться в другом, потому что они никак не синхронизируются, ты не можешь приметить цветовую схему для всей программы, потому все плагины индивидуально настраиваются, ты устанавливаешь плагин и видишь краказябры, потому что какого-то шрифта в системе не хватает - и прочее и прочее. Потом ты окрываешь Idea, видишь там, например, предиктивный автокомплит, который ты раньше даже не замечал, потому что… а в смысле, а чо такова? и понимаешь, что две недели на настройку Emacs ты потратил абсолютно впустую. https://www.linux.org.ru/forum/development/17471550?cid=17472261 И вообще весь тред про ужасное качество инструментов под линукс. Особенно в "stable" (r) (tm) Debian
#BGCWUS (1+1) / @bga_ / 280 дней назад
xxx: Я не люблю когда на ООП ДРОЧАТ БЛЯДЬ В ЭЛЕМЕНТАРНЫХ ВЕЩАХ xxx: KISS! xxx: Я пишу на руби
#M2LYV5 (4) / @manul / 2884 дня назад
Давайте накидаем здесь ссылки или хотя бы названия хороших проектов на node js желательно с открытым кодом чтобы можно было оценить красоту/уродство
#CPG0HI (6) / @omth / 3650 дней назад

http://goo.gl/jxJS6u

#S3ENPL (6) / @lord / 3807 дней назад

Фронтендные технологии всегда были и будут говном. Prove me wrong.

#40GGTN (2+1) / @nixer / 3833 дня назад

Читаю про шаговые двигатели и драйвера к ним. Завтра пойду пробовать на практике. А, да, завтра еще скорее всего поиграюсь с этим вашим модным ардуино.

#21WWUX (2) / @tdc / 3859 дней назад

Как нынче модно хранить вложенные коллекции в human-readable/editable-виде?

#5IH5IH (4) / @nixer / 3874 дня назад

Собрал тулчейн для iOS в Linux, собрал хеллоуворлд, закинул в быдлодевайс и увидел, что оно работает. Вроде бы было несложно, но теперь придётся пердолиться в ОБДЖЕКТИВ ССЫ чтобы написть что-нибудь полезное ._.

#QJEMSJ (4) / @like-all / 3911 дней назад

JS Source is base64'd and inlined as a variable into a generated C file
JS Source is base64'd and inlined as a variable
base64'd and inlined

Удобно.

#XTYUK6 (0) / @like-all / 3913 дней назад

Повебота

#JJYQEY (0) / @kerrigan / 3942 дня назад

Немногим языкам удается реализовать map таким образом, что ["1", "2", "3"].map(parseInt) выльется в [1, NaN, NaN]

#LTL4KN (3+1) / @mendor / 3955 дней назад

...а ты теперь всегда вместо фразы "мой проёб" используешь "особенности реализации"?

#FE419X (0) / @mendor / 3962 дня назад

Сегодняшнее прекрасно: http://xkcd.com/1296/

#3L8GSJ (0+1) / @mendor / 3970 дней назад

http://zero.milosz.ca/

#A1QCU4 (0) / @mendor / 3971 день назад

Don't mess with OCaml! http://rain.ifmo.ru/~olegfink/ocaml.html

#T3JKBP (0+1) / @mendor / 3984 дня назад

Цоперайт © 2010-2012 @stiletto.\nУже конец 2013 года, блядь.

#5VAFWX (3) / @anonymous / 3986 дней назад

UNIX V5, OpenBSD, Plan 9, FreeBSD, and GNU coreutils implementations of echo.c
https://gist.github.com/dchest/1091803

#IF7BWB (4+1) / @mendor / 4013 дней назад
ipv6 ready BnW для ведрофона BnW на Реформале Викивач Котятки

Цоперайт © 2010-2016 @stiletto.